What are the factors of 2x^2+11x+15

Respuesta :

jimrgrant1 jimrgrant1
  • 16-04-2020

Answer:

(x + 3)(2x + 5)

Step-by-step explanation:

Given

2x² + 11x + 15

Consider the factors of the product of the coefficient of the x² term and the constant term which sum to give the coefficient of the x- term

product = 2 × 15 = 30 and sum = + 11

The factors are + 6 and + 5

Use these factors to split the x- term

2x² + 6x + 5x + 15 ( factor the first/second and third/fourth terms )

= 2x(x + 3) + 5(x + 3) ← factor out (x + 3) from each term

= (x + 3)(2x + 5)
